oden.billy@epamail.epa.gov. U.S. Environmental Protection Agency
intends to issue Request For Quotations (RFQ) to sources that have been
qualified as capable of performing professional services in support of
the Agency's effort to prepare a document describing the scientific
basis for review and possible revision of the current National Ambient
Air Quality Standards (NAAQS) for particulate matter (PM). These
previously qualified sources were identified through responses to
USEPA's Commerce Business Daily (CBD) announcement of 02/20/98, which
expressed that the Agency was seeking potential sources possessing
scientific backgrounds and extensive knowledge of particulate matter
with the capability to provide USEPA with high quality assessment of
the latest available scientific information to be used in support of
the next PM NAAQS review. Previously qualified sources were evaluated
based on submission of: curriculum vitae, publication history and other
written materials that described scientific expertise, and evidence of
previous contributions to similar assessments. Interested parties not
previously qualified will be required to submit similar materials to
establish qualifications with their proposals. The required services
will involve the completion of several tasks, which could involve: (1)
authorship of one or more technical draft sections of the new PM Air
Quality Criteria Document (AQCD); (2) participation in scientific
peer-review meetings / conferences (travel will be required); (3)
attend CASAC Review Meeting and assist in the revision of the draft PM
ACQD in response to CASAC review and public comments; and (4) assist
in developing responses to comments received from the public and from
the Clean Air Scientific Advisory Committee of EPA's Science Advisory
Board. A detailed Statement of Work will be issued with the RFQ.
Requests for Quotations will be issued to previously qualified sources
on 05/28/98, providing for a response time of a maximum of 14 days.
EPA intends to issue a firm-fixed price purchase order, with a cost
reimbursable line item for Travel. Issuance of a purchase order will be
based on technical qualifications and low price. Interested parties who
